# Firmware Update Channel: Limits & Quotas

Devices on the Ostrel fleet poll the update channel on a jittered schedule. Quotas exist to keep the distribution tier from melting during a fleet-wide rollout: per-device download caps, concurrent-session ceilings, and a rollback window after which old images are purged. Contractors: do not raise these without sign-off from the fleet team, and never bypass the staged-rollout percentage gates. Exceeding quota returns a retry-after response; clients must honor it. The enforced limits are defined below.

limits module of fajog-tawig:
RATE_LIMITS = {
    "druwyn": 2,
    "quenael": 10,
    "wenix": 2,
    "druael": 2,
}

## Formula sandbox tuning

User-supplied formulas in Gridmoor execute inside a restricted interpreter with hard ceilings on time, memory, and call depth. Reviewers should confirm any change to these ceilings is justified in the PR description, since raising them widens the abuse surface. Defaults were chosen from production traces. The current limits are as follows.

limits module of tafog-fawip:
WEIGHTS = {
    "julix": 57,
    "lamys": 992,
    "kasvan": 209,
    "quenok": 750,
    "alddor": 259,
    "oliath": 1009,
    "wenix": 815,
}

Runbook: Tilehound prefetcher. If prefetch stalls, check the fetch queue depth first. Over 10k: restart the worker pool. Under 10k with zero throughput: the upstream tile token has expired. Do not regenerate tokens yourself; request one from the platform channel. Once received, open /etc/tilehound/worker.env and replace the stale entry with the new credential on the following line.

vault entry, yahif-yajep: COURIER_KEY29=b802bdf8034096b65a51c6ba5abe2

## Read-Replica Lag Alarm

New folks: the ReplicaLagHigh alarm covers the Ostrel reporting replicas. It fires when lag exceeds 90 seconds for five minutes. Most triggers come from the nightly Bramwell export job, which is expected and auto-resolves. Do not fail over the replica yourself — that requires the data-platform lead's approval and a change ticket. If the alarm persists past 20 minutes with no export running, write to the platform inbox.

billing contact of yahip-yadup = eliax.druix@zemvarworks.corp